End-to-end engineering solutions for embedded systems, real-time control, and IoT applications. Services cover the entire development lifecycle — from initial concept and prototyping to industrial-scale implementation—ensuring optimal hardware-software integration and reliable performance.
Development capabilities include ESP32, STM32, and Arduino architectures, as well as C/C++ programming.
Service Capabilities:
- Microcontrollers and Firmware: Custom firmware development for ESP32 and STM32, RTOS (FreeRTOS) integration, and real-time system implementation.
- Communication Protocols: Integration of standard industrial and commercial protocols (I2C, SPI, UART, Modbus, CAN, MQTT, etc.).
- IoT and Telemetry: End-to-end Wi-Fi/Bluetooth connectivity and sensor integration for industrial and commercial environments.
- Hardware Engineering: Control system integration and design of drive circuits for motors and loads.
- PCB Design: Schematic capture, multi-layer layout design, component selection, rapid prototyping, and DFM (Design for Manufacturing) optimization.
